Have you added the External API?
It's on the tab Workspace > Workspace settings... > External APIs > Check the Geckolib API (Legacy)
Save changes and then MCreator will ask to refactor the Workspace, press yes and after this it should be there the options in the +!
If the ExternalAPI is not showing the Geckolib option then check which version/generator you're using to see if your MCreator and generator is compatible with the plugin version here
(Also on your MCreator's Preferences > Manage Plugins you need to Check the box 'Enable Java plugins', otherwise nothing of it will work.
